Depot cuts ribbon on $11M missile facility
Letterkenny Army Depot will be working on the business end of Patriot missiles. Top brass cut the ribbon Friday on the $11.6 million Theater Readiness Monitoring Facility.

Specter announces 100 more jobs for depot
Sen. Arlen Specter said on Wednesday that a partnership with Raytheon could bring an additional 100 jobs to Letterkenny Army Depot.

York BAE plant gets $601 million Army contract
BAE Systems announced Tuesday it was awarded a $601 million U.S. Army contract to repair and upgrade 606 heavy infantry vehicles.

Continuous Process Improvement workshop held
Lean practitioners from across the Department of Defense came together to share, learn and educate each other during a Continuous Process Improvement workshop, held April 22 and 23 at Tobyhanna Army Depot.
